Question on Digicams:
What's a good digicam that's really pocketable? I was hoping to get something under 20mm thick, about the size of a normal cell phone.Submitted by CNET Asia reader, via email
Answer:
Leonard Goh
Writer
An entry-level slim shooter would be the Olympus FE-320. For a budget point-and-shoot, it performed better than we expected compared to other compacts in its class.
If you're looking for slim, stylish cameras, then you can't possibly go wrong with Sony's T-series. The Cyber-shot DSC-T300 is sleek but the image quality may not go down well with everyone. Its successor, the T700 is less than 20mm in thickness but is not available yet. Check back our site at a later date for its review.
